The Silent Drain of Manual Processes
Consider the cumulative impact of these manual processes. An HR team member spending hours weekly on data entry isn’t just performing a task; they’re foregoing opportunities to engage with employees, develop strategic talent initiatives, or analyze critical HR metrics that could inform business decisions. The hidden costs extend beyond just salaries; they include delayed hiring cycles, frustrated new hires due compliance paperwork, inconsistent data leading to poor reporting, and a reduced capacity for proactive HR leadership. In an era where employee experience and talent retention are competitive differentiators, a bogged-down HR department is a significant liability.
Many businesses attempt to patch these problems with more staff or by acquiring more specialized software without a cohesive strategy for integration. The result is often a collection of siloed systems that don’t communicate, creating new manual workarounds and perpetuating the very inefficiencies they were meant to solve. This fragmented approach not only fails to deliver promised efficiencies but can actually increase operational complexity, making it harder for HR to become a true strategic partner to the business rather than just an administrative cost center.

Realizing Tangible Benefits: Beyond Efficiency
The benefits of an automated HR function extend far beyond mere efficiency gains. While reducing manual hours and eliminating human error are immediate wins, the strategic value is profound. HR professionals are freed from administrative burdens, allowing them to focus on high-impact activities such as talent development, employee engagement, culture building, and strategic workforce planning. This shift transforms HR from a reactive administrative department into a proactive, strategic pillar of the organization, directly contributing to growth, retention, and overall business success.
